1 Features
•1 Junction Temperature Range –55°C to 125°C
• Integrated Shielded Inductor
• Simple PCB Layout
• Flexible Startup Sequencing Using External Soft-
Start and Precision Enable
• Protection Against Inrush Currents and Faults
such as Input UVLO and Output Short Circuit
• Single Exposed Pad and Standard Pinout for Easy
Mounting and Manufacturing
• Fast Transient Response for Powering FPGAs
and ASICs
• Low Output Voltage Ripple
• Pin-to-Pin Compatible With Family Devices:
– LMZ14203EXT/2EXT/1EXT
(42-V Maximum 3 A, 2 A, 1 A)
– LMZ14203/2/1 (42-V Maximum 3 A, 2 A, 1 A)
– LMZ12003/2/1 (20-V Maximum 3 A, 2 A, 1 A)
• Fully Enabled for WEBENCH® Power Designer
• Electrical Specifications
– 6-W Maximum Total Output Power
– Up to 1-A Output Current
– Input Voltage Range 6 V to 42 V
– Output Voltage Range 0.8 V to 6 V
– Efficiency up to 90%
• Performance Benefits
– Low Radiated Emissions and High Radiated
Immunity
– Passes Vibration Standard MIL-STD-883
Method 2007.2 Condition A JESD22–B103B
Condition 1
– Passes Drop Standard MIL-STD-883 Method
2002.3 Condition B JESD22–B110 Condition B

3 Description
The LMZ14201EXT SIMPLE SWITCHER® power
module is an easy-to-use step-down DC-DC solution
capable of driving up to 1-A load with exceptional
power conversion efficiency, line and load regulation,
and output accuracy. The LMZ14201EXT is available
in an innovative package that enhances thermal
performance and the device allows for hand or
machine soldering.
The LMZ14201EXT can accept an input voltage rail
between 6 V and 42 V and can deliver an adjustable
and highly accurate output voltage as low as 0.8 V.
The LMZ14201EXT only requires three external
resistors and four external capacitors to complete the
power solution. The LMZ14201EXT is a reliable and
robust design with the following protection features:
thermal shutdown, input undervoltage lockout, output
overvoltage protection, short-circuit protection, output
current limit, and allows startup into a prebiased
output. A single resistor adjusts the switching
frequency up to 1 MHz.
